Output 598312d65bf590b3e2c547074272cd4cc17b4085246c8494badf5ff61047e30c:1

value
11001500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e73970f8f8c1f5e0b91b055c4368e55fec30677d OP_EQUAL
address
3NmcpwwLfdMBXcbucnhxBd9i91Qtrfr7ae
transaction
598312d65bf590b3e2c547074272cd4cc17b4085246c8494badf5ff61047e30c
spent
true